Recently VOCs become one of the most interesting compounds in the atmospheric environ men t because of its toxicity, carcinogenesis. durability . dispersion characteristics and accumulation in human body with very low level. Also. it was proved that VOCs act as the precursors of oxidants forming. So kinds of analysis methods were recommended and carried out toward the standardization. generally the thermal desorption/GC/MS(or FID) system is recommended as a standard method. Nevertheless. because this method needs an expensive special equipment and continuous maintenance. it makes difficulties to measure spatial distributions of VOCs in ambient air. Therefore in this study we evaluated the passive sampler which were designed as a measuring tool of working area conditions, on the purpose of measuring the spatial distribution or average concentration of VOCs in the ambient air. This study was carried out to estimate the sampling period of passive sampler, to evaluate repeatability. reproducibility of GC/FID analysis results. and to examine calculation procedure. As the results. the sampling period must be satisfied to capture more than 1 ppm (ng/㎕) of VOC in the liquid sample. so at least 7days or more are needed in ambient air sampling. The repeatability and reproducibility which are examined by relative standard deviation(%) with a point of retention time and peak area at within-run and between-run analysis were proved to be suitable. And the calibration method was examined by least square. logarithmic and constant slope method. among these methods the outcome of least square method was superior (r value exceeds 0.998).
